I own a Murray Rider Lawn Mower (425600x8A.  The engine is made by Briggs/Stratton.  The engine will not start.  It turns over and I am getting spark. If I pour gas directly into the air filter it will start but will not continue to run....I have checked everything except the carburator.  I have found the adjusts on it and the settings.  Will this fix my problem?  If not how to I know if the fuel solenoid is bad?  What else could be the source of the problem?

 Take the Fuel line off of the carb and let it drain into a bucket & turn it over and see if fuel come out! It is possible that it is the Fuel filter or the float is stuck in the carb!
